Forstalment
Defined in 2 dictionaries — Kinney (1893), Burrill (1850)
A Law Dictionary and Glossary
George C. Kinney · 1893
In old English law. An obstruction or stopping of a way.
A New Law Dictionary and Glossary
Alexander M. Burrill · 1850
[L. Lat. forstallamentum.] An obstruction or stopping of a way; (obstructio viae, impedimentum transitus.) Co. Litt. 161 b. Fleta, lib. 1, c. 42.
